On ferromagnetism and antiferromagnetism

1972 
Considering spin lattice systems interacting through arbitrarily many-body and indefinitely-long-range interactions, we look at geometric or algebraic conditions to ensure a convergent time development. We pone positivity or semi-boundedness requirements for induced Hamiltonians in the extremal « semi-symmetric » states, using the adjacency of two intertwining lattices, as Neel did, to describe ferromagnetic and antiferromagnetic behaviours. We essentially deal with spin 1/2, but rough indications are given how to manage the results when arbitrary spins are involved.
